FAQ

What is Polaris's current debt?
Polaris (PII) reported current debt of $34.8M in Q2 2026.
How has Polaris's current debt changed year-over-year?
Polaris's current debt decreased by 92.0% year-over-year, from $434.5M to $34.8M.
What is the long-term trend for Polaris's current debt?
Over 5 years (2020 to 2025), Polaris's current debt has grown at a -24.5%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$142.1M to $34.8M.
What does current debt mean?
The portion of long-term debt maturing within the next 12 months, requiring refinancing or repayment from operating cash flows.
